Job Summary:
The Shoe Room Operative is responsible for meticulously assembling and stitching various components of product uppers according to specifications, ensuring high-quality craftsmanship and adherence to production targets. This role requires precision, attention to detail, and proficiency with industrial sewing machines and related equipment.
Key Responsibilities:
Final Finishing and Detailing:
- Cleaning, spraying, and polishing the shoe uppers (the main body).
- Antiquing, staining, waxing, and buffing the sole edges and heels.
- Fitting internal socks, insoles, laces, and adding decorative tags or embellishments.
- Performing a meticulous final check of the shoe for any marks, defects, or quality issues.
- Ensuring the pair is an exact match in terms of colour, finish, and size.
- Wrapping and packaging the finished shoes.
- Boxing the shoes and ensuring the correct labels/tickets are applied.
- Preparing the packaged goods for storage or shipment.
